4G (fourth generation cellular technology) LTE in the US relies on frequencies 
from 700MHz to 2.5GHz, with the lower frequencies being best suited for 
covering long distances and penetrating building walls. The FCC's vote today 
proposes new "flexible use service rules in the 28GHz, 37GHz, 39GHz, and 
64-71GHz bands," and seeks public comment on other bands above 24GHz that could 
also be used.
